MTN Nigeria recorded major wins at the 2025 CIO & C-Suite Conference & Awards, held on Saturday, November 22, 2025, at the Civic Centre, Lagos. The company clinched three top honours: its Chief Information Officer, Shoyinka Shodunke, was named Overall Best CIO and Tech Champion of the Year, while MTN Nigeria also received the TechCo Innovation Excellence Award.
The clean sweep at the annual event—organised by The CIO Club Africa and convened by Abiola Laseinde—reinforces MTN’s continued leadership in technology, innovation, and enterprise transformation. Themed “Tax Meets Tech: Africa’s Leap to a Digital Economy,” this year’s edition brought together key executives, policymakers, and innovators shaping Africa’s digital landscape.
Though Shodunke was absent, the MTN Nigeria delegation, led by Ude Enebeli, General Manager, Information Technology Service Management, represented the company impressively—demonstrating the strength and depth of MTN’s technology leadership.
